Film Description

Aka Pelota vasca: La piel contra la piedra (The skin against the stone). Thought-provoking and controversial documentary about the Basque conflict and identity from one of Spain's foremost filmmakers, who calls it 'an invitation to a discussion'.

Review by Barry Forshaw on 2nd August 2004

A fascinating picture of one of Europe’s most remarkable regions, with its mix of ancient cultural identity and unceasing political violence. Julio Medem made his mark with the much-acclaimed Sex and Lucia (not to mention the award-winning The Red Squirrel) , and is the perfect guide to the contradictory intricacies of the region. In Basque Ball, Medem has produced not only the largest-grossing Spanish documentary film ever made, but has taken a scalpel to the mindset behind the political reality. This always fascinating and provocative film explores the unique language and long-held traditions of the Basque region’s ancient mores, and the bloodshed perpetuate by the implacable separatists. Sporting a mélange of archive footage and film extracts, Basque Ball also has an intriguingly wide range of interviews with contemporary poets, musicians, politicians, and even victims of terrorism. The film has been given suitably deluxe treatment by Tartan; apart from the Dolby Digital 5.1 surround sound (why shouldn’t documentaries enjoy this facility?), extra insight is provided by Spanish film specialist Robert Stone (not the novelist), and the experienced journalist Paddy Woodworth, an expert on Spain’s political turmoil.
